Joshua Francisco Mitchell is an English filmmaker, best known for his independent directing, especially with micro-budget projects. He has created multiple award-winning short films, all with a common style of realism accentuated with comedy. The most recent of which are the award winning ‘The Slip Up (2026)’ and 'Bingo (2026)'. Previous shorts (‘Over-Kneaded’, ‘A Helping Hand’) are available to view on the CrocodileTears.uk website. These were also written and produced by Joshua. He is driven by character and choice, believing that action requires repercussion. It’s through this methodology that he creates realistic characters that drive the story with a building sense of tension.
